{Paper Doll • ology}

Announcing {Paper Doll • ology}, a new online tutorial. Wouldn't you like to be able to create something like this? This tutorial is meant to be a step by step guide to helping you create your own original, fanciful, paper art doll. The outline for this class will be submitted to publishers as a book proposal. I hope to include a gallery section using works from students of this tutorial.

Basic Supplies:
Craft Knife (required)
Cutting Matt (required)
Detail Scissors
Liquid Adhesive
Decorative Papers in text and card weight
Plain Papers in text and card weight
Other supplies will be posted with each lesson
